Byggmax: Transforming Procurement with Digital Contracts
Byggmax, a leading Nordic home improvement retailer, faced a common issue: paper-based procurement contracts slowed everything down. Processing contracts manually created unnecessary delays and inefficiencies—especially with over 300 suppliers to manage.
With Oneflow’s digital contracts, Byggmax:
- Made procurement processes 15x faster
- Improved efficiency by 12x
- Streamlined contract handling with fewer resources

Systembolaget: Total Oversight Across 3,000+ Vendor Agreements
Systembolaget, Sweden’s state-owned alcohol retailer, operates across a vast vendor network. The team in charge of indirect sourcing sought greater visibility and control over thousands of contracts.
After testing multiple solutions, they chose Oneflow. The results?
- A centralised digital contract system
- Greater transparency and auditability
- Improved compliance and document tracking
